The person must be either the citizen of USA or the permanent residence to be eligible to avail from various FL Medicare plans. Those who are below the age of 65 years but are disabled or have ESRD (End-stage renal disease) can also apply for these Florida Medicare plans.

Florida Medicare Plans are of two types: Original Medicare and Medicare Advantage plans and are divided into different categories. Let us know about these categories.

Part A or Hospital Insurance: This insurance is free for all the US citizens and permanent resident and covers inpatient care in hospitals, home health care and hospice etc.

Part B or Medical insurance: This insurance is optional as the patient has to pay some amount as premium every month and gets cover for various medical necessities such as home health services, doctor’s services, outpatient care and durable medical equipment etc.

Part D or Medicare Prescription Drug Coverage: Plan A and B do not cover prescription drug coverage, which is covered in this plan D. To enjoy the prescription drug coverage, you must join the plan run by Medicare or other private insurance company approved by Medicare. One can enroll for plan D if he is enrolled with Plan A and B but will likely to pay late enrollment penalty.
